The street in brief

Rosemary Close is mostly terraced houses. The median sale price is £144,250, about 52% below the typical PO21 sale. Recent sales are too thin to call a trend for the street itself; PO21 prices as a whole have been easing. HM Land Registry records 6 sales across 4 homes since 2005 — homes here come up rarely.

Rosemary Close's £144,250 median sits about 52% below PO21's £299,475.

Street and PO21 figures are medians of HM Land Registry sales; the England figures are the UK House Price Index mix-adjusted average — a different basis, so compare direction rather than levels between the two.
